Turn Your Lights Green for Veterans

Raleigh, N.C. – For the second year in a row, the North Carolina Department of Military and Veterans Affairs (NC DMVA) is taking part in a statewide initiative for the week of Veterans Day (November 6th - 12th, 2023) urging everyone to display or turn their exterior lights green in honor of our servicemen and women. The Department will light the headquarters located in the historic Seaboard Building, 413 N. Salisbury St., Raleigh, beginning November 3rd.

NC DMVA is urging homeowners, businesses, and all levels of government to participate in Operation Greenlight to honor and show support for veterans inclusive of all military branches. This initiative will also raise awareness about the challenges faced by many of these men and women who have selflessly served our state and nation.

Operation Green Light encourages everyone to light up their homes and public spaces with green light bulbs in support of North Carolina’s veterans during November 6th – November 12th. Veterans Day is celebrated on November 11th.

“Our veterans deserve honor and recognition every day. Operation Green Light offers everyone an opportunity to demonstrate our support for our veterans and their families. We are grateful for their sacrifices,” said LtGen Walter E. Gaskin, USMC (Ret.), Secretary of NC DMVA. “We can do small things with great love; their world will shine a little brighter when we all join our lights together.”
